Description
Crispy on the outside and tender inside, these salmon patties are a nostalgic and delicious treat perfect for any occasion.
Ingredients
Scale
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 green onions, chopped
- 1 shallot, finely diced
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 2 teaspoons lemon juice, freshly squeezed
- 1 teaspoon Old Bay seasoning
- 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
- 2 large eggs, beaten
- 2 cans (15 ounces each) pink salmon, drained
- 1/2 cup panko breadcrumbs
- Oil for light frying
Instructions
- In a blender or food processor, combine garlic, green onions, shallot, parsley, lemon juice, Old Bay seasoning, sea salt, and beaten eggs. Blend for 30 to 45 seconds until finely broken down.
- Open the canned salmon, remove pin bones or skin, and flake into a large bowl.
- Stir panko breadcrumbs and the blended onion mixture into the flaked salmon until well combined.
- Warm a skillet over medium-high heat and drizzle with oil. Form about 1/3 cup of the salmon mixture into a patty.
- Place patties in the skillet, cooking for 3 minutes until golden brown on one side. Flip and cook for an additional 2 to 3 minutes.
- Transfer the cooked patties to a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il. Serve warm with a dipping sauce.
Notes
For a healthier option, you can bake the patties at 375°F for 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way through.
